Tradewind Recruitment is seeking an enthusiastic Humanities Teacher to inspire students across History, Geography, and Religious Education in Manchester. This full-time, long-term position requires Qualified Teacher Status (QTS) and allows you to cover a range of humanities subjects.

You will create engaging, inclusive lessons that foster understanding and appreciation in learners. Join a supportive academic community dedicated to excellence. Position begins ASAP for the remainder of the academic year.

How to prepare for a job interview at Tradewind Recruitment

Know Your Subjects Inside Out

Make sure you brush up on the key concepts and themes in History, Geography, and Religious Education. Be prepared to discuss how you would engage students with these subjects and share examples of lessons you've created or taught in the past.

Show Your Passion for Teaching

During the interview, let your enthusiasm for teaching shine through. Share stories about how you've inspired students in the past and your approach to creating inclusive lessons that cater to diverse learning needs.

Familiarise Yourself with the School's Values

Research Tradewind Recruitment and the specific school culture in Manchester. Understanding their commitment to excellence and how they support teachers will help you align your answers with their values during the interview.

Prepare Thoughtful Questions

At the end of the interview, you'll likely have the chance to ask questions. Prepare insightful queries about the school's approach to humanities education, professional development opportunities, and how they support new teachers. This shows your genuine interest in the role.
